OPEN EVERYDAY 10-7PM | ALWAYS OPEN ONLINE

Belgium's Finest Desserts by Imperial

Belgium's Finest Desserts by Imperial

Regular price $12.00 Sale

Pamphlet

1968 publication by Imperial Products, known for their pudding and cornstarch, among other star ingredients.